A Wine Lover’s Guide to Traverse City Wineries

Traverse City has become one of the top wine destinations in the Midwest, thanks to its cool climate, scenic vineyards, and award-winning wines.

With more than 40 wineries in the region, visitors can enjoy unforgettable tasting experiences just minutes from the city.

Old Mission Peninsula Wine Trail

Just north of downtown Traverse City, Old Mission Peninsula features breathtaking vineyards overlooking Grand Traverse Bay.

Popular wineries include:

  • Chateau Chantal
  • Bowers Harbor Vineyards
  • Bonobo Winery

Leelanau Peninsula Wine Trail

Another must-visit destination for wine lovers is the Leelanau Peninsula.

Here you'll find:

  • Boutique wineries
  • Charming coastal towns
  • Scenic countryside drives

It’s the perfect setting for a leisurely wine-tasting day.
